CVP Case with Mixed Costs Morrison Corporation is a small company that sells digital thermometers and other supplies to hospitals in the Phoenix, AZ area. The company employs one sales agent who earns both a salary and commission. Last year, Morrison Corporation purchased a new Subaru Impreza for $25,000 for the sales agent to use for 100% business transportation. The company controller estimated that the Impreza would have a five-year life and a residual value of $6,000. The company uses straight-line depreciation for all plant assets. The costs for this year specifically related to the Impreza are insurance for $1,000, fuel for $5,000 and other costs. The controller estimates that with the increase in fuel costs, that the amount next year for fuel will increase by 5%. The controller believes that the insurance cost will stay constant. The other costs include maintenance, fixing flat tires, oil changes, tickets, parking, car washes/detailing, etc. The other costs for the Impreza for each month of last year is below. Miles Driven Total Other Cost January February 3,367 330 3,453 329 March 1,255 140 April 4,892 490 May 1,629 400 June 5,478 518 July 5,381 506 August 6,933 549 September 3,983 369 October 3,630 343 November 4,762 462 December 2,815 261 Total 47,578 The controller had prepared a Budgeted Income Statement for next year, but didn't include the costs for the Impreza. The Budgeted Income Statement is below: Morrison Corporation Budgeted Income Statement Sales 1,500,000 Commissions 75,000 Other Variable Costs 500,000 575,000 Contribution Margin 925,000 Fixed selling costs 400,000 Fixed administrative costs 300,000 700,000 Net Operating Income 225,000
